What Is a Hybrid Cloud Environment?
A hybrid cloud environment combines multiple infrastructure models into a unified ecosystem.

Typically, hybrid architectures include a mix of:

Public cloud services

Private cloud environments

On-premises infrastructure

Dedicated server resources

This approach allows organizations to place workloads where they perform best while maintaining flexibility and control.

For example, businesses might host customer-facing applications on cloud hosting platforms while keeping sensitive databases on dedicated infrastructure.

What Is a Dedicated Server?
A dedicated server is a physical machine allocated exclusively to a single customer.

Unlike shared or virtualized environments, dedicated servers provide complete access to:

Processing power

Memory

Storage

Network resources

Organizations gain greater control over configurations, security settings, and resource allocation.

Dedicated infrastructure remains a preferred choice for businesses requiring predictable performance and enhanced customization.

Hybrid Cloud vs Dedicated Servers: Key Differences
Feature

Hybrid Cloud

Dedicated Server

Scalability

Excellent

Limited by hardware capacity

Performance Consistency

Varies by deployment

Highly predictable

Resource Sharing

Often includes virtualized environments

Exclusive resources

Customization

Moderate

Extensive

Initial Investment

Lower upfront costs

Higher dedicated commitments

Security Control

Shared responsibility

Greater direct control

Deployment Speed

Rapid provisioning

May require setup time

Both approaches offer valuable capabilities depending on organizational priorities.

Cost Analysis
Infrastructure costs vary depending on workload characteristics.

Hybrid Cloud May Be Ideal For:
Variable workloads

Seasonal demand fluctuations

Rapid growth scenarios

Dedicated Servers May Be Better For:
Predictable usage patterns

Long-term deployments

Performance-sensitive applications

Evaluating total cost of ownership is essential.

The lowest upfront cost does not always represent the best long-term value.
